best replacement carb for 1978 454 burban
Yeah thats me banging my head, just bought a 1978 Suburban with a 454 . The fuel consuption is worse that it should be even for a 454 . Since it is not burning all the fuel the existing carb is dumping now, 5.7 MPG sucks big time. What is a good replacement carb, brand and vendor ID# Thanks for your help |

Re: best replacement carb for 1978 454 burban
We have an 82 chevy C-30 crew cab truck with swapped in 427, th-400 trans and 4.11 rear axle ratio. We were getting 5-7 mpg at first. Thought Q-jet problem so got rebuilt Q-jet from napa and gained 1 mpg. Called Summit Racing and ended up with a Holley 650 spreadbore, model 4175 and set it up with the "stiff" spring that controls the 4bbl and we were up to around 9 mpg. We have very few problems with Holley, they were the OEM carb on 366,427 and 454 in the bigger trucks. A set of exhaust headers and dual exhaust 3" with H-pipe got us in the 10-11mpg range, and we are happy with that. We also run a 14x4 open element ait filter. Hope that helps you with your 'burb.
